Nerve Conduction Study (NCS) is a diagnostic test that measures the speed and strength of electrical signals traveling through your nerves. This non-invasive procedure helps neurologists diagnose various neurological conditions and assess nerve damage.

NCS testing is crucial for diagnosing conditions like carpal tunnel syndrome, peripheral neuropathy, nerve injuries, and other neurological disorders. It helps determine the exact location and severity of nerve damage, enabling targeted treatment plans.
Remove jewelry and metal objects. Clean skin areas to be tested. No special fasting required.
Small electrodes are placed on your skin over the nerves to be tested.
Brief electrical pulses stimulate the nerve while recording the response.
Computer records nerve conduction speed and response strength.
Neurologist analyzes results and provides comprehensive report.

NCS testing involves mild electrical stimulation that may cause a brief tingling or tapping sensation, but it's generally not painful. Most patients describe it as mildly uncomfortable but tolerable.
The complete NCS test typically takes 15-30 minutes, depending on how many nerves need to be tested. The actual testing time is usually shorter than the total appointment time.
Results are typically available within 24-48 hours. Your neurologist will review the findings and discuss them with you during a follow-up consultation.
NCS is a very safe procedure with minimal risks. There are no known side effects, and you can resume normal activities immediately after the test.
